In order to provide you with information about events near you, the app sometimes needs to determine your approximate location. This is done using the phone's built-in GPS. The location is only used to determine which events are relevant to you. Each time a new location is retrieved the previous one is deleted, so it is not possible to track how your phone has moved over time.
SOS Alarm does not know who has downloaded the app and does not save or track any location information beyond what is described here.
If you have turned off location services on your phone, the app will not have access to your location. In that case no GPS information will be sent to SOS Alarm.
For the app to work as intended you need to allow "Always allow exact location" in your phone's settings.
